disagreeable
English
Etymology
From Old French desagraable (compare French désagréable). Surface etymology is dis- +? agreeable.
Pronunciation
- (UK) IPA(key): [d?s????i.?b??]
Adjective
disagreeable (comparative more disagreeable, superlative most disagreeable)
- Causing repugnance; unpleasant to the feelings or senses; displeasing.
- (archaic) Not suitable; that does not conform or fit.
Usage notes
- Nouns to which "disagreeable" is often applied: odor, smell, taste, sensation, thing, person, man, woman, duty, work, feeling, manner, experience, effect, feature, business, surprise, job.
Antonyms
- agreeable
Translations
Noun
disagreeable (plural disagreeables)
- Something or someone displeasing; anything that is disagreeable.
- 1855, Blackwood's magazine (volume 77, page 331)
- The disagreeables of travelling are necessary evils, to be encountered for the sake of the agreeables of resting and looking round you.

revolting
English
Pronunciation
- Rhymes: -??lt??
Verb
revolting
- present participle of revolt
- The peasants are revolting!
Noun
revolting (countable and uncountable, plural revoltings)
- revolution (The action of the verb to revolt)
- 1837, The American Biblical Repository (volume 9, page 316)
- Yet revoltings of the soul would attend this violence to nature, this abuse of physical and intellectual energy, while the beauty of social order would be defaced, and the fountains of earth's felicity broken up.
- 1837, The American Biblical Repository (volume 9, page 316)
Adjective
revolting (comparative more revolting, superlative most revolting)
- repulsive, disgusting
- The most revolting smell was coming from the drains.
